    Here at BSD, we are flying on all the choppers. It’s good on one side because it never gets boring and it’s bad on the other side because if you are flying only one type of chopper, you’ll get less opportunity to fly. The K50 is a geat chopper for the complexity of its systems, but there is so much assistance that flying her is relatively easy. On the side of the ED offer, the Huey is super basic but her flight model makes it master. In the middle, you have the Mi8 and the gazelle.

    I hope soon the Mi24 will be available and my guess is that everybody will want to fly her as it a bit of a mix between an mi8 and a ka50.

    Furthermore I'd highly recomend getting a second heli for cross training. You see flying as lead with an helicopter which can literally brake withing a blink of an eye is kinda tricky if you have a helicopter right by your side which hates to change it's current flying condition. Let's take the UH-1 (Huey) as an example that thing needs miles to slow down from 100 kts to a dead hover. The SA342 (Gazelle), however, can stop literally on the spot. That way you'll get a grasp for decelerating in formation flight.
